Лабораторная работа 3 по дисциплине: "Программирование". Вариант 7. СИБГУТИ
Состав работы
|
|
|
|
|
|
Работа представляет собой zip архив с файлами (распаковать онлайн), которые открываются в программах:
- Microsoft Word
Описание
Вариант 7
Лабораторная работа №3
Тема 1: Работа с одномерными массивами.
Тема 2: Подпрограммы: процедуры и функции.
Общий текст задания для всех вариантов:
Задана последовательность значений элементов некоторого массива до и после преобразования по некоторому правилу. Определите алгоритм преобразования и напишите программу, которая:
1) формирует массив из заданного количества случайных целых чисел в заданном диапазоне и выводит элементы массива на экран;
2) по определенному вами алгоритму преобразовывает этот массив и выводит на экран элементы преобразованного массива.
3) производит заданные вычисления и выводит результат на экран.
Задание для 7 варианта:
Массив K = (5, –5, 4, 9, –7, –11, 0) преобразован к виду K = (0, 1, 0, 0, –1, –5, 0). Размер массива K - 21 элемент из диапазона [–56,56]. Вычислить сумму тех элементов преобразованного массива, которые находятся в диапазоне [–1, 16].
Лабораторная работа №3
Тема 1: Работа с одномерными массивами.
Тема 2: Подпрограммы: процедуры и функции.
Общий текст задания для всех вариантов:
Задана последовательность значений элементов некоторого массива до и после преобразования по некоторому правилу. Определите алгоритм преобразования и напишите программу, которая:
1) формирует массив из заданного количества случайных целых чисел в заданном диапазоне и выводит элементы массива на экран;
2) по определенному вами алгоритму преобразовывает этот массив и выводит на экран элементы преобразованного массива.
3) производит заданные вычисления и выводит результат на экран.
Задание для 7 варианта:
Массив K = (5, –5, 4, 9, –7, –11, 0) преобразован к виду K = (0, 1, 0, 0, –1, –5, 0). Размер массива K - 21 элемент из диапазона [–56,56]. Вычислить сумму тех элементов преобразованного массива, которые находятся в диапазоне [–1, 16].
Дополнительная информация
Год сдачи: 2022
Оценка: зачет
Уважаемый ...., Ситняковская Елена Игоревна
Оценка: зачет
Уважаемый ...., Ситняковская Елена Игоревна
Похожие материалы
ДО СИБГУТИ Лабораторная работа №3 по дисциплине "Программирование игр" (2026)
Mijfghs
: 31 марта 2026
Лабораторная работа №3: Редактор уровней.
Целью работы является получение навыков создания редакторов трёхмерных сцен.
Задания:
1. Создать 2 или более панелей объектов. Осуществить переключение между панелями при помощи элемента интерфейса Dropdown.
2. Добавить на информационную панель возможность переименовать выбранный объект.
3. Добавить на информационную панель возможность вращать выбранный объект.
4. Добавить возможность перемещать выбранные объекты по вертикали.
5. Реализовать с
1500 руб.
Лабораторная работа №3 по дисциплине Программирование на языке высокого уровня (часть 2) СибГУТИ вариант 7
skivjeka
: 4 ноября 2011
Лабораторная работа №3
Работа с функциями языка Си
Задание 1 : Используя функцию, написать программу по своему варианту.
Вариант задания 1.
7. Написать функцию, которая сортирует одномерный массив в порядке убывания методом пузырька. В основной программе вызвать эту функцию для двух разных массивов.
Лабораторная работа №3 по дисциплине: Программирование (часть 1). Вариант 7
Roma967
: 18 июня 2024
Лабораторная работа № 3
Тема 1: Работа с одномерными массивами.
(в лекциях см. п. 4.1)
Тема 1: Подпрограммы: процедуры и функции.
(в лекциях см. п. 5)
Общий текст задания для всех вариантов:
Задана последовательность значений элементов некоторого массива до и после преобразования по некоторому правилу. Определите алгоритм преобразования и напишите программу, которая:
1) формирует массив из заданного количества случайных целых чисел в заданном диапазоне и выводит элементы массива на экран;
250 руб.
Лабораторная работа № 3 по дисциплине Функциональное и логическое программирование. Вариант 7
Некто
: 16 сентября 2018
Условие задачи:
Определите на языке ЛИСП функционал, аналогичный встроенному предикату MAPLIST для одноуровнего списка. (Используйте применяющие функционалы). Проверьте работу функционала для функций:
-REVERSE;
-LIST.
50 руб.
Лабораторная работа №3 по дисциплине "Программирование на языке Си". Вариант №7
Jack
: 29 октября 2014
Тема: Работа с функциями языка Си
Задание 1: Используя функцию, написать программу по своему варианту.
Написать функцию, которая сортирует одномерный массив в порядке убывания методом пузырька. В основной программе вызвать эту функцию для двух разных массивов.
150 руб.
Лабораторная работа №3 по дисциплине: «Объектно-ориентированное программирование». Вариант №7
kiana
: 27 октября 2014
Тема:
Принцип наследования.
Создание иерархии классов.
Классы и модули.
Задание:
Создать иерархию графических классов в соответствии с рисунком. Описания классов оформить в отдельном модуле.
Рекомендации к выполнению:
В данной лабораторной работе Вы должны написать, откомпилировать и сохранить модуль, содержащий описание классов графических фигур. Для этого изучите в лекциях §9 “Классы и модули” и разберите в примере 2.7 (§10) конспекта лекций модуль FIGURA. Т.е. Вы должны прислать на прове
50 руб.
ДО СИБГУТИ Лабораторная работа №3 по дисциплине "Программирование трехмерной графики (часть 2)" (2025)
Mijfghs
: 18 октября 2025
Лабораторная работа №3: Динамическое создание объектов.
Цель: Целью лабораторной работы является знакомство с методом динамического создания и
уничтожения объектов в среде Unity.
Задание:
Создать интерактивное приложение трёхмерной графики, содержащее следующие механики:
1. Возможность перемещения по сцене в режиме от первого лица.
2. Возможность производить выстрел из оружия.
3. При выстреле, из оружия должна вылетать модель гильзы. Гильзы должны пропадать спустя
некоторое время.
4
900 руб.
ДО СИБГУТИ Лабораторная работа №3 по дисциплине "Программирование и обработка графического интерфейса (часть 2)" (2025)
Mijfghs
: 2 сентября 2025
Лабораторная работа №3: Инкапсуляция. Повторное использование классов.
Цель работы:
- Знакомство с принципом инкапсуляции.
- Применение ранее разработанных классов.
Задачи:
- Реализовать программу согласно описанному функционалу.
- Создать класс для хранения числовых данных в формате массива и использовать класс для хранения больших чисел.
- Разработать систему классов для реализации логики программы. Классы должны удовлетворять принципу инкапсуляции.
Функционал программы:
- Загру
444 руб.
Другие работы
Компьютерные вирусы
Aronitue9
: 2 мая 2012
Содержание
Введение ……………………………………………………………………………………...3
Компьютерные вирусы: начало …………………………………………………....3
Классификация и разновидности компьютерных вирусов …………...6
Проявление наличия вируса в работе на компьютере ……………………8
Методы защиты от компьютерных вирусов …………………………………..9
Действия при заражении вирусом ………………………………………………..12
Заключение ………………………………………………………………………………...13
Источники информации ..…………………………………………………………….13
В наше время очень широко используются компьютеры, почти в кажд
20 руб.
Численное интегрирование определённых интегралов
Lokard
: 10 августа 2013
АННОТАЦИЯ
В данной работе будут рассмотрены три метода приближённого интегрирования определённого интеграла: метод прямоугольников, метод трапеций и метод Симпсона. Все эти методы будут подробно выведены с оценкой погрешности каждого из них. Для более полного восприятия материала в работу помещён раздел, в котором подробно расписано решение, всеми тремя методами, определённого интеграла. В материале имеются иллюстрации, с помощью которых, можно более глубоко вникнуть в суть рассматриваемой темы
20 руб.
Лабораторные работы по дисциплине: Информатика (часть 2). Вариант общий
Учеба "Под ключ"
: 30 декабря 2016
Лабораторная работа №1
"Оформление документов"
Содержание отчета:
- Титульный лист
- Пример отформатированной объяснительной записки с вашим текстом
- Пример заполненного бланка резюме с вашими данными
ВНИМАНИЕ! В резюме и в объяснительную записку вставьте свои данные!
Лабораторная работа №2
"Подготовка комплексных текстовых документов в среде редактора Microsoft Word"
Содержание отчета:
Часть 1. Текст файла Таблица
Часть 2. Текст файла Диаграмма
Часть 3. Текст файла Рисунок
Часть 4. Текст файл
400 руб.
Расчет экономических показателей работы отделения железной дороги
Qiwir
: 15 ноября 2013
Содержание курсового проекта
Введение
Раздел I. Производственная техноэкономическая характеристика Отделения дороги.
Раздел II. Расчет объёмных показателей по грузовым перевозкам Отделения дороги.
Раздел III. Расчет качественных показателей по грузовым перевозкам
Раздел IV. Расчет объёмных показателей пассажирских перевозок
Раздел V. Расчет приведенных тонно-км
Раздел VI. Расчет объёмных показателей использования подвижного состава
Раздел VII. Расчет качественных показателей использования
10 руб.